    PS5 Pro and PSSR

    PS5 Pro and PSSR

    Episode 152

    The specs for the PlayStation 5 Pro have leaked, and they paint a picture of high resolutions and framerates via Sony's proprietary upscaling solution, PSSR. But do we need a PlayStation 5 Pro? Today, we discuss the Pro specs and the technology behind them, and talk about historical mid-gen refreshes and they impact they have. As always, we conclude with the games we are playing (Helldivers 2, Balatro, Baldur's Gate 3). This episode was recorded in March 2024. Royalty free music from BenSound.
